POP Peeper

POP Peeper



POP Peeper is a small utility that runs in your Windows system tray. It visually and audibly lets you know if you have email on any number of POP3 and IMAP servers as well as Gmail, Hotmail, Yahoo and other web mail providers. It allows you to preview the headers of your email, and view the messages. There is also support for file attachments, which allows you to view the name of the files. If you are checking multiple accounts, you can specify a custom color for each, making it easy to distinguish the messages. Message preview is quick and fully supports HTML messages. Using POP Peeper, you can quickly scan what messages are important enough to read, and which ones you want to delete without even opening your email client.
